★ ★ ★ myBuick Overview

     

What is myBuick? The myBuick mobile app is a convenient tool that helps simplify, add control, and reach your vehicle's full potential. It allows you to stay in touch and in command of your vehicle, whether you're in it or not. You can access helpful features like remote commands, vehicle status, roadside assistance, and more.

myBuick functions

- Remote Commands: You can lock and unlock your doors or warm up your car on a cold morning using the app.

- Vehicle Status / Schedule Service: You can monitor your vehicle's fuel level, oil life, tire pressure, and more, making it easy for you to stay on top of your vehicle's health and schedule service with your participating dealer without leaving the app.

- Roadside Assistance: You can request roadside assistance in the app or call an OnStar Advisor if you have a flat tire or need fuel.

- How Things Work: You can view tutorials and access your owner's manual to learn more about your vehicle, from setting up your Bluetooth connection to advanced safety features.

- Send to Navigation: You can plan your trip by sending a destination to your vehicle's built-in navigation system from the app.

- Buick Smart Driver: You can gain insights about your driving skills and receive a driving score for a trip, day, week, or month. You will also receive driving tips to help you become a better and safer driver.

- Disclosures: The app is available on select devices, and service availability, features, and functionality vary by vehicle, device, and the plan you are enrolled in. Terms apply. Device data connection is required. Some features require a paid plan, and limitations and restrictions apply.

  • Not reliable enough

    By p2g2 (Pcmac user)

    Love the concept of this app. Primary use case is to be able lock my keys and iPhone in my Regal, go for a run in the park, come back to my car and unlock it with my Apple Watch. Should be simple enough, but it’s a roll of the dice every time I come back from my run - could take 10 seconds, but more often takes much longer. I look and feel really dumb standing outside my car sweating in the sun while I keep clicking on the unlock button, eventually rebooting my watch, hitting it a couple of more times, then finally getting it to work 15 minutes after I started. There’s clearly message queuing issues between the Watch app and iPhone app. And speaking of that, at this point in the development lifecycle, there’s no reason that a cellular Apple Watch should need to be connected to an iPhone in order to work; it should be able to connect directly with OnStar web services.
